To guarantee image clarity, vibrancy, and longevity, canvas prints are produced using premium materials & cutting-edge printing techniques. For a smooth & long-lasting printing surface, the canvas is usually composed of polyester or cotton. For long-term color brightness maintenance, UV-resistant inks are used during printing. The canvas is stretched and wrapped around a wooden frame after printing to create a finished piece that is ready to hang.

There is a large selection of canvas print sizes to choose from, ranging from 8×10 inch to 40×60 inch. Canvas prints can be customized to fit a range of interior design preferences and spatial requirements thanks to their variety in size, shape, & style. When you make an investment in gorgeous canvas prints for your home, it’s critical to take good care of them and keep them looking good for a long time. Your canvas prints will continue to look brilliant and immaculate for many years to come with regular upkeep. The following advice will help you take good care of and preserve your canvas prints: 1. Dust Often: Dust off your canvas prints with a soft brush or microfiber cloth on a regular basis.

By doing this, you can lessen the chance of dirt and debris building up on the print’s surface. 2. Steer Clear of Direct Sunlight: Hang your canvas prints away from heat sources like radiators & fireplaces to avoid fading and discolouration. Sun exposure should be kept to a minimum whenever feasible, however UV-resistant inks can help lessen its effects. No 3. Handle with Care: Take extra caution not to scratch or harm the surface of your canvas prints when moving or cleaning them.

Lift them from the sides or back rather than gripping the front of the print. 4. . Clean Spills Quickly: To avoid irreversible damage, gently blot any spills or stains on your canvas prints with a clean cloth as soon as they happen. Steer clear of abrasive materials or harsh cleaning agents as they may damage the print. 5. . Professional Cleaning: You should think about speaking with qualified art conservators or restorers who specialize in taking care of canvas artwork if your canvas prints need more thorough cleaning or restoration because of wear and tear over time. You can enjoy your canvas prints as focal points in your home decor for years to come by taking care of them and keeping them in good condition with these upkeep tips.

What is a picture to canvas?

A picture to canvas is the process of transforming a digital or physical photograph into a canvas print. This involves printing the image onto a canvas material, typically using a high-quality inkjet printer.

How is a picture to canvas made?

To create a picture to canvas, the digital or physical photograph is first prepared for printing. The image is then printed onto a canvas material using a specialized inkjet printer. Once the printing is complete, the canvas is stretched and mounted onto a frame, ready to be displayed.

What are the benefits of picture to canvas prints?

Picture to canvas prints offer several benefits, including a unique and artistic way to display photographs, a durable and long-lasting display option, and the ability to customize the size and style of the canvas print to suit individual preferences.

What types of photographs can be turned into canvas prints?

Almost any type of photograph, whether digital or physical, can be turned into a canvas print. This includes family portraits, landscapes, travel photos, and more. The quality of the original photograph will impact the final result of the canvas print.

How should I care for a picture to canvas print?

To care for a picture to canvas print, it is best to avoid direct sunlight and high humidity, as these can cause fading and damage to the print. Regular dusting with a soft, dry cloth is recommended to keep the canvas clean.
